What Is A Swing Bucket Centrifuge . The two main types of rotors used in laboratory centrifuges are horizontal (also called swinging bucket) and fixed angle (or angle head) rotors. Swing out rotors on the other hand hold sample buckets on an axle allowing the sample to swing outwards at a varying angle, depending.
